Long beans, also known as yard-long beans or asparagus beans, are a delicious and easy-to-grow addition to any container garden. With their delightful taste and simple cultivation process, they are the perfect choice for gardening enthusiasts between 45-65 years old. Let’s dive into the steps to grow thriving long bean plants in containers:
Step 1: Get Your Seeds Ready
Start by soaking the long bean seeds in water for 24 hours. This helps to soften the seed coat and kickstart the germination process. You will be amazed by how quickly they sprout!
Step 2: Choose the Perfect Containers

Prepare your seedling containers by placing two long bean seeds along with two aloe vera cuts in each container. Cover them lightly with soil and keep the containers moist. This creates an ideal environment for the seeds to grow.
